Closed. This question does not meet Stack Overflow guidelines。它当前不接受答案。












想要改善这个问题吗?更新问题,以便将其作为on-topic用于堆栈溢出。

7个月前关闭。



Improve this question




我正在按照以下说明在Windows 10的WSL 2上运行Docker Daemon:

https://medium.com/@callback.insanity/upgrading-to-wsl-2-9883688fcfa5

但是,当我尝试启用基于实验性WSL 2的引擎时,无法选择此复选框,如下所示:

windows - "Enable the experimental WSL 2 based engine"无法选择-LMLPHP

我正在运行Windows 10 build 1909
消息显示为:



我不在快速跟踪程序或Insider Preview程序中(并且我也不想成为),但是对于我的构建是否满足此要求,我一点也不了解。我正在运行WSL 2(是的,它很不错,除了它似乎并没有像我所希望的那样与Docker一起工作)。

我面临的问题是我的Windows构建版本是否太低,还是应该尝试其他方法?

更新:
如以下注释中所指出的,我的Windows的版本号内部版本号不同。我通过查看系统信息来检查内部版本号,看到我的内部版本号是18362。

最佳答案

1909的数字比19018的数字小。另外,我认为您现在必须处于Insider Preview程序中才能启用该选项。

https://docs.docker.com/docker-for-windows/wsl-tech-preview/

windows - "Enable the experimental WSL 2 based engine"无法选择-LMLPHP

我和你在同一条船上;我也很想使用它,但是不想加入Insider程序,所以我只是想耐心等待它。

关于windows - "Enable the experimental WSL 2 based engine"无法选择,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/60711205/

10-10 09:36